How To Choose a Lawn Care Provider

Professional lawn care companies can help you achieve a lush lawn through services like weed control, fertilization, and insect prevention. This guide highlights important factors to consider when selecting the right residential lawn care provider for you.

Assess Years of Experience

Look for a lawn care company that’s been serving homeowners in Washington Court House for at least five years. An established company will have extensive knowledge of common pests, the local climate, the soil, and other lawn challenges. They'll also know the right timing for key treatments across the seasons.

Evaluate Offered Services

Core lawn treatments include weed control, aeration, and fertilization. Many providers also offer additional services such as lime treatment, seeding, and tree trimming. Your company should consider your desired results for your lawn and customize your plan accordingly.

Examine Product Offerings

Professional lawn care providers use high-quality fertilizers, herbicides, and other residential lawn care products. You can also ask the company about organic treatment options if you want fewer harsh chemicals on your lawn.

Look For Customized Lawn Care Plans

Avoid lawn care providers that use one-size-fits-all treatments. The best companies tailor service plans based on your needs. After reviewing a lawn care plan, you should clearly understand what treatments your providers will use, and on what schedule.

Evaluate Responsiveness and Communication

Select a lawn care company that communicates effectively. Look for responsiveness, great customer service, and proactive outreach. The company should answer all of your questions, notify you about upcoming visits, make you aware of problems, and take the time to understand what you want your lawn to look like.

Check Reviews and Ask Neighbors for Referrals

Reviews on sites like Yelp, the Better Business Bureau (BBB), and Google Reviews provide information about a lawn care company's past service record and reputation. You can also ask for recommendations from neighbors who've hired local lawn services previously.

Lawn Care Services in Washington Court House

Washington Court House's local lawn care professionals offer a variety of services. Some popular lawn care services include the following:

  • Seeding/Overseeding: Seeding and overseeding introduce grass seed to your lawn to fill bare or sparse patches. Seeding requires fully turning over the soil and is often a one-time job. Overseeding involves sprinkling grass seed as needed.
  • Weed Control: Lawn care professionals can eliminate weeds using both manual and chemical techniques. This makes more room for your grass and plants to grow.
  • Aeration: Lawn aerating involves making small perforations in the soil. This aids growth by allowing air, water, and nutrients to circulate more freely.
  • Pest Control: If pests like bugs or moles are harming your lawn, many local lawn care companies can help with pest control. Ensure that any technician who applies pesticides on your property is authorized by the EPA.
  • Fertilization: Fertilizing your lawn can boost its health, promote faster growth, and boost resistance to diseases. Ask your lawn specialist about options for natural fertilizers.
  • Soil Care: Your lawn company can test the pH balance of your soil and improve it by adding lime. This helps make sure your lawn has all the nutrients it needs.

Below, we outline the average cost of these and other lawn care services in Washington Court House.

ServiceCost
Lawn Care$71-$160
Lawn Weed Control$76-$89
Lawn Fertilization$45-$134
Lawn Seeding$624-$891
Lawn Overseeding$267-$445
Lawn Aeration$76-$111
Lawn Soil Care$18-$89
Lawn Leaf Removal$67-$445
Lawn Snow Removal$67-$134
Lawn Mowing$107-$160
Lawn Edging$18-$89
Lawn Tree & Shrub Care$267-$535
Lawn Pest Visit$89-$1,158

The best plan for you will be based on your views on the trade-off between DIY work and the expense of hiring a pro. If you handle everything yourself, you won't have to pay for labor, but this option will necessitate the most effort from you. If you hire a full-service lawn care company, they'll handle all the logistics and labor, but you will need to invest more money up front. Subscription lawn care companies are somewhere in the middle. They provide the materials, and you do the application.

Year-round, your lawn should receive weed and pest control, tree and shrub care, and aeration and fertilization as needed. During the warmer months, you'll also want to add seeding/overseeding and soil care. When it starts to get cooler, you may need leaf and snow removal, and you might consider winterizing your lawn. When you use a lawn care company, you also get the benefit of professional expertise. These experts can determine exactly what your lawn needs, when it needs it, and how often it requires servicing. They also provide the products and (if you hire a full-service company) the labor, which are usually backed by guarantees.

When it comes to taking care of your lawn, consistency is key. You'll want to do some services, like mowing, every one or two weeks. Some services – like pest and weed control – can be done less frequently. Things that may affect your lawn care schedule include the state of your lawn at the onset, the weather in your part of Ohio, and the time of year.
